Display

The display shows the current room temperature via the built-in sensor of the VRF HMI unit (factory setting). Alternatively, temperature setpoint or temperature value from VRF indoor unit can be used for the display (P06).

Setpoint adjustment and limitations

The factory setting for the basic setpoint is 21 ℃. The setpoint can be adjusted via the +/- buttons. The minimum (P09) and maximum (P10) setpoint limitations can be used to save energy.

There are two different concepts below:

P09<P10 (comfort concept) - typical use case for VRF indoor unit

If the minimum setpoint (P09) is set below the maximum setpoint (P10), the heating setpoint can be adjusted between these two limits. The users desired setpoint and the VRF HMI unit provides the setpoint setting to the VRF indoor unit controls the room temperature accordingly.

P09≥P10 (energy saving concept)

If the minimum limit P09 is set above the maximum limit P10

  • The setting range of heating setpoint is 5 ℃…P10 rather than 5…40 ℃.
  • The setting range of cooling setpoint is P09…40 ℃.

As a result, the maximum heating setpoint or minimum cooling setpoint can be limited, thus saving energy and lowering costs.

Keylock

Keylock can be activated or deactivated via parameter P14 (see Control parameters) when the unit is in ON and OFF mode.
